Landslide

 
I signed the work Saturday, 10th of November. It already rained all day, followed by torrential downpours during the night.
I was planning to stay in bed all day, I was totally exhausted from the very hard finishing days just behind me, when a disturbing email arrived, the marble factory seemed to have suffered a landslide, so I got dressed and made my way down to the factory, which is a 10 min walk from the house I was staying in.
And this is what I witnessed:


 


I had to save most of my tools out of the flooded area, but the Petacci Marble factory was very severely hit. No electricity, no water, structural damage and the generally overwhelming damage meant that the factory was pretty much out of business for the rest of the year.
In the end, I was really lucky, as the sculpture was finished, just about 4 hours before the landslide. On Monday, we decided, that the best solution would be to store the sculpture in the factory (as access for transport was unavailable for 4 weeks anyhow)
So, it was time, to wrap up the soggy tools and say goodbye to all the chaos.
But I will be back, and hope, it won’t be too long.
